New Veterinary Laboratory to Enhance Agricultural Research in Agadir
The Hassan II Agronomic and Veterinary Institute has allocated over 5 million dirhams for the establishment of a new veterinary laboratory within the Agadir Horticultural Complex. This state-of-the-art facility is set to become a pivotal resource for regional research and development.
In line with its developmental agenda, the Agadir Horticultural Complex (CHA), part of the Hassan II Agronomic and Veterinary Institute (IAV), has officially commenced the construction of this advanced laboratory, which will include various ancillary facilities. This initiative is designed to bolster the complex's standing as an international horticultural hub, complemented by an experimental farm spanning 23 hectares and a business incubator for agricultural entrepreneurs.
Additionally, the project encompasses an analysis laboratory, a research and development unit, and a center of excellence that will be associated with a consortium dedicated to research, development, and innovation. The establishment of the regional development company "Agricultural Innovation" is also noteworthy; this initiative stems from a partnership between the CHA and the Souss-Massa regional council. The total budget allocated for the execution of this veterinary laboratory and its associated facilities amounts to 5.2 million dirhams.
Comprehensive Facilities for Advanced Veterinary Services
Covering a land area of approximately 2,900 square meters within the Agadir horticultural complex, the project is geared toward creating a functional building that can accommodate multiple components. The architectural design aims to ensure that the building evolves with time while considering accessibility and the integration of the project within its surroundings. The goal is to harmoniously fit the laboratory into its environment while effectively managing its connections with adjacent buildings and existing pathways.
The physical program for the veterinary laboratory is centered around a dissection room and an autopsy room. Surrounding these core areas are specialized diagnostic units, including a pathology service, a tissue bank laboratory, an imaging unit, and an anatomy laboratory, thus ensuring a complete and integrated analytical chain. Post-mortem management will be facilitated through a spacious bone workshop and an ossuary, alongside a cold chain comprising three distinct cold storage rooms and a dedicated biological storage area. Environmental safety is a top priority, as the facility will include waste treatment areas for both hazardous and non-hazardous materials, supplemented by a slaughterhouse and a dissection material storage room, among other services.
In tandem with the architectural elements, technical studies and construction monitoring have commenced, aimed at delivering a comprehensive execution dossier that encompasses all essential construction specifications for a research environment, along with a detailed preliminary project for contractor consultations. Another aspect focuses on the control and optimization of technical studies and construction work, which includes establishing safety notices, validating technical studies, and overseeing the construction process until final acceptance.
